About this service

If your garage door reverses immediately after starting to close, your safety sensors are likely misaligned or faulty. These sensors keep pets and people safe by detecting obstructions. How does a side mount garage door opener work?

A side mount garage door opener, also known as a jackshaft opener, is mounted on the torsion spring shaft, offering a clean ceiling aesthetic and freeing up overhead space. What is involved in garage door torsion spring repair?

Garage door torsion spring repair is a critical safety service performed by licensed, insured pros. These springs, mounted above the garage door, store and release energy to counterbalance the door's weight. When a torsion spring breaks or weakens, it can make the door difficult or impossible to lift safely. Pros will carefully de-tension the old spring, if possible, and replace it with a new one correctly sized for the door's weight, ensuring proper balance and smooth operation.
